On the 6th day of recruiting myths: Myth #6: “Colleges don’t recruit from high school programs.” It’s true. I’ve never seen a D1 coach at a high school game. Maybe 1-2 make it out to the big well known pre-season tournaments, but in most states, HS ball is in the middle of their own season. So this myth is mostly true if you’re in the D1 or bust mentality. Almost all of us start with that goal, but there are a million things that have to go just right to make that happen. There are plenty of players with enough talent to play D1 that don’t start there. I know this because I played with some amazing ones. They ended up going the JUCO route for one reason or another, killed it as All-Americans, and are now playing at a higher level. I had local JUCO coaches at our HS games all the time. I actually saw them more often in high school than I did at the club tournaments I played in. Even if you think you’re destined for D1, it’s important not to discount it. What happens if you’re injured your sophomore or junior year, or you developed a little too late for D1 programs who have filled their class? What happens if your freshman grades sunk your GPA? What if the programs that offer you don’t have enough athletic aid to make the finances work for your family? To say all recruiting happens in club is more like saying I’m only interested in one path to my goal. And… if you kill it in high school season and get some recognition it can be enough to catch the attention of D1 programs. I had a good friend that nailed it her junior year. She had not received any offers going into May, but her HS season was incredible. She made zero errors all season! Her bat was 🔥 and she ended up getting selected as the Conference Offensive Player of the Year across the state of Arizona. She posted the award on X and immediately she had a D1 coach follow her. That coach eventually came to watch her play in club and have her out for a visit. The award didn’t get her an offer and neither did the high school play directly, but it built enough credibility to get some interest. And for people outside the “recruiting bubble”, these seemingly little things can be the tipping point. She’s a freshman this year playing D1 softball. So… if you’re thinking High School sports don’t provide recruiting opportunities, you’re thinking too narrowly. The opportunity looks different, but it’s still an opportunity to increase your odds of playing at the next level. #RecruitingRules Rule #2: Build your brand. Create your own luck - High school sports provided one of the best opportunities I had to build my brand. Local media coverage. State tournaments and awards. Those are things that don’t happen often in club. The coaches might not be at the field to watch during their own season, but that doesn’t mean you can’t keep building your brand to improve your opportunities later!

Before My Friend Took His Life, He Mailed Me a Letter Blame Covid, isolation, or economics, but many men my age are struggling with how life has turned out By Charlie LeDuff (Charlie LeDuff) My friend took his life last week. He wasn’t the first friend to do that over this past year. He wasn’t even the second. A lot of guys my age are struggling with the idea of suicide. It’s reached a level of crisis in America, the scientific papers say. Brought on by the Covid-19 pandemic and its aftermath. The scientific papers cite factors like isolation and economic hardship. That’s just a fancy way of saying life hasn’t worked out for some guys of my generation. Not the way we were trained to imagine our older selves when we were boys, anyway. My friend’s name was Mickey. Mickey’s letter arrived at my home a few days after he ended it all. He wanted to explain things. He wanted to apologize. “I’m sorry,” the letter began. “I will be discovered in the garage, behind my car, in the recycle bin, for ease of removal.” That really struck me. Mickey—always the urbane and cultured man—had literally thrown himself away. “For ease of removal.” In the letter, Mickey detailed how he had exhausted his savings and was unable to find meaningful work after being dismissed from his job during the pandemic. Mickey had worked for three decades in international trade and logistics. Now, having reached the upper limits of middle-age, the phone wasn’t ringing anymore. He was broke. And the credit companies were squeezing him. “Combined with a significant loss of confidence and hope, I’ve given up,” he wrote. “This is not the position I expected to be in at this point in my life, and it is simply too much to continue.” Mickey left just enough for the cremation. He was 61. Mickey had no wife, no children, no live-in lover that I know of. But he had friends and family who loved him. Depression can make you blind, I suppose. And why didn’t we see Mickey’s depression? The grind of the day-to-day difficulties dulls the senses, I suppose. So Mickey spent his last hours, alone, addressing envelopes and scratching out his own obituary. Imagine that. Writing your own obituary. I suppose this is my attempt at his epitaph. Mickey was a decent and honest man. If the meaning of life is to be found in one another, then without you, life will have less meaning for those you leave behind. The world is a poorer place without Mickey in it. But I’m a richer man for having known him. If you feel at the end of your rope, friend; or if you’re considering a rope or a rubbish bin, please call. That’s all. Just start with a call.
